next up previous contents index
Next: Implementation Fib-Sprachelemente Up: Projektstruktur der Implementation Previous: Projektstruktur der Implementation   Contents   Index

Abhängigkeiten der Module

In Abbildung 12 sind die Abhängigkeiten der einzelnen Module dargestellt. Hier wurde der Vererbungspfeil zwischen den "enviroment" und "enviroment.fib" sowie den "operation" und "fib.operator" Modulen benutzt, um darzustellen, dass die entsprechenden Fib-Module Spezialisierungen der "enviroment" sowie "operator" Module darstellen.

Figure: Abhängigkeiten der Module
Image modul_dependencies

Die Abbildung 13 zeigt die Abhängigkeiten der Hauptmodule noch einmal in einer anderen grafisch Form.

Figure: Abhängigkeiten der Hauptmodule
Image ProjektAbhaengigkeiten

Das "enviroment.fib" Modul benötigt zwar für seine Individuen die Fib-Objekte, dies jedoch nur als Namen (für Fib-Objekte). Das "enviroment.fib"-Modul benötigt also nur einen Namen für Fib-Objekte und kein Wissen über die Funktionsweise (Methoden) der Fib-Objekte. Daher ist dass "enviroment.fib"-Modul nicht von "fib"-Modul abhängig.



Betti Österholz 2013-02-13